Jump to content
  • Checkout
  • Login
  • Get in touch

osCommerce

The e-commerce.

advanced search with price doesn't work.


Dennis_gull

Recommended Posts

Posted

Hey, I've installed quite a lot of contributions with sql changes and today I found out that search by price didnt work I get this error when I try to search:

1064 - You have an error in your SQL syntax. Check the manual that corresponds to your MySQL server version for the right syntax to use near 'select count(distinct p.products_id) from products p left join

select count(*) as total from (select count(distinct p.products_id) from products p left join manufacturers m using(manufacturers_id) left join specials s on p.products_id = s.products_id left join tax_rates tr on p.products_tax_class_id = tr.tax_class_id left join zones_to_geo_zones gz on tr.tax_zone_id = gz.geo_zone_id and (gz.zone_country_id is null or gz.zone_country_id = '0' or gz.zone_country_id = '203') and (gz.zone_id is null or gz.zone_id = '0' or gz.zone_id = '0'), products_description pd, categories c, products_to_categories p2c where p.products_status = '1' and p.products_id = pd.products_id and pd.language_id = '1' and p.products_id = p2c.products_id and p2c.categories_id = c.categories_id and ((pd.products_name like '%neverwinter%' or p.products_model like '%neverwinter%' or m.manufacturers_name like '%neverwinter%') and (pd.products_name like '%nights%' or p.products_model like '%nights%' or m.manufacturers_name like '%nights%') and (pd.products_name like '%2%' or p.products_model like '%2%' or m.manufacturers_name like '%2%') ) and (IF(s.status, s.specials_new_products_price, p.products_price) * if(gz.geo_zone_id is null, 1, 1 + (tr.tax_rate / 100) ) >= 1) and (IF(s.status, s.specials_new_products_price, p.products_price) * if(gz.geo_zone_id is null, 1, 1 + (tr.tax_rate / 100) ) <= 100) group by p.products_id, tr.tax_priority order by pd.products_name) as SubQ1

 

does anyone know how to fix this?

Archived

This topic is now archived and is closed to further replies.

×
×
  • Create New...